1) Basic Rules and Manners for Darts Game
- 
                    
                    Enjoy playing while observing rules. - In any sports, what is more important that playing it well is to observe the rules. 
 - Start a darts game with a greeting, take turns with your opponent after throwing three darts at the throw line and
 applaud your opponent for a good play. These are the basic manners for enjoying a good darts game.

                    Darts Game Rules - A process to decide who is to throw darts first is called 'diddle' or 'cork'.
 Decide the order by flipping a coin or playing the rock-paper-scissors game.
 Then, a player who throws a dart closer to the bull starts the game first.- One throw is where a player throws three darts. After completing a throw, take turns with your opponent.
 When both players complete a throw each, a single round is completed.- Make sure to stand inside the throw line when throwing darts.
 If a local rule prescribes for players to stand in front of the throw line, follow the local rule.

                    Etiquettes - It is dangerous to throw darts as if pitching balls in a baseball game. It can also damage the machine and darts.- It is prohibited to play darts when you are excessively drunk or have a cigarette in your mouth.- Do not throw darts across an adjacent machine or towards people.- When handing over a dart, hold the tip so that the flight faces the person to whom you are giving the dart.- Do not make loud noise or jeer when your opponent is set up to throw darts.- Give words of compliment when your opponent wins a high score or put up a good play.
 - Be sure to greet your opponent before and after a game by shaking hands or putting your fists against your opponent's.
